Cooking , also known as cookery or professionally as the culinary arts , is the art, science and craft of using heat to make food more palatable , digestible , nutritious , or safe. Cooking techniques and ingredients vary widely, from grilling food over an open fire , to using electric stoves , to baking in various types of ovens , reflecting local conditions. Types of cooking also depend on the skill levels and training of the cooks. Cooking is done both by people in their own dwellings and by professional cooks and chefs in restaurants and other food establishments. Preparing food with heat or fire is an activity unique to humans. Archeological evidence of cooking fires from at least , years ago exists, but some estimate that humans started cooking up to 2 million years ago.

Dry heat food preparation do not utilize water to cook foods and therefore are able to reach hotter temperatures. Roasting is a cooking method that uses dry heat. Roasting can enhance flavor through caramelization and Maillard browning on the surface of the food. Roasting uses indirect, diffused heat as in an oven , and is suitable for slower cooking of meat in a larger, whole piece. Meats and most root and bulb vegetables can be roasted. Any piece of meat, especially red meat that has been cooked in this fashion is called a roast.

Dry-heat cooking methods are those that do not require additional moisture at any time during the cooking process. After brushing with oil or butter, fish can be grilled directly on the grate or placed on a heated platter under the broiler. Broiled or grilled fish should have a lightly charred surface and a slightly smoky flavor as a result of the intense radiant heat of the broiler or grill. The interior should be moist and juicy.
